Comparing Norway with Lawton, Oklahoma

Compare Climate information for Norway and Lawton, Oklahoma

Is Norway warmer or hotter than Lawton, Oklahoma?

On average across the year, no, Norway is not hotter than Lawton, Oklahoma . Norway has an average temperature of 7°C/45°F and Lawton, Oklahoma has an average temperature of 17°C/63°F.

Norway's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 20°C/68°F, which is not hotter than Lawton, Oklahoma's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 36°C/97°F).

Is Norway colder or cooler than Lawton, Oklahoma?

On average across the year, yes, Norway is colder than Lawton, Oklahoma . Norway has an average minimum temperature of 4°C/39°F and Lawton, Oklahoma has an average minimum temperature of 10°C/50°F.



Norway's coldest month is January, with an average minimum temperature of -3°C/27°F, which is approximately the same temperature as Lawton, Oklahoma's coldest month (also January, with an average minimum temperature of -3°C/27°F).

Does Norway have more rain than Lawton, Oklahoma?

On average across the year, yes, Norway has more rain than Lawton, Oklahoma. Norway has an average annual rainfall of 791mm and Lawton, Oklahoma has an average annual rainfall of 747mm.

Norway's wettest month is October, with an average monthly rainfall of 93mm, which is drier than Lawton, Oklahoma's wettest month (May, with an average monthly rainfall of 135mm).
